| Re: preparing flounders what do you mean cheifs !!! im sure im a chef the best way to fillet a flat fish is to lay on chopping board with the tail pointing towards you, with a sharp filleting knife cut a straight line from just below the head to the tail then turn your knife to a slight angle and run the knife from the top to the botton along the top of the back bone working your way to the outside of the fish ,keep you knife as close to the bone as possible , im sure theres a video on here somewhere showing how to do it ,good luck ![]() __________________ obsessed is a word used by the lazy to describe the dedicated .. species hunt team winner 2005 and 2006..with old smoothy.. |
